34 | /* A trace state variable is a value managed by a target being |
35 | traced. A trace state variable (or tsv for short) can be accessed | |
36 | and assigned to by tracepoint actions and conditionals, but is not | |
37 | part of the program being traced, and it doesn't have to be | |
38 | collected. Effectively the variables are scratch space for | |
39 | tracepoints. */ | |
40 | ||
41 | struct trace_state_variable | |
42 | { | |
43 | /* The variable's name. The user has to prefix with a dollar sign, | |
44 | but we don't store that internally. */ | |
45 | const char *name; | |
46 | ||
47 | /* An id number assigned by GDB, and transmitted to targets. */ | |
48 | int number; | |
49 | ||
50 | /* The initial value of a variable is a 64-bit signed integer. */ | |
51 | LONGEST initial_value; | |
52 | ||
53 | /* 1 if the value is known, else 0. The value is known during a | |
54 | trace run, or in tfind mode if the variable was collected into | |
55 | the current trace frame. */ | |
56 | int value_known; | |
57 | ||
58 | /* The value of a variable is a 64-bit signed integer. */ | |
59 | LONGEST value; | |
00bf0b85 SS |
60 | |
61 | /* This is true for variables that are predefined and built into | |
62 | the target. */ | |
63 | int builtin; | |
64 | }; | |
